Energy Efficiency

Vassilis is committed to energy efficiency, implementing various strategies to minimize energy consumption in his properties. These include passive solar design, energy-efficient appliances, and renewable energy sources.

Sustainable Materials

Sustainable materials are used extensively in Vassilis' properties, from locally sourced wood to recycled steel and glass. These materials not only reduce the environmental impact of construction but also contribute to the overall aesthetic of the properties.
